1. Logitech MX Vertical:

  • Comfort & Ergonomics: 5/5 - Unique 57° angle minimizes wrist strain, sculpted grip accommodates various hand sizes.

  • Functionality: 4/5 - 7 programmable buttons, smooth scrolling wheel, gesture support.

  • Connectivity: 3/5 - Logitech Flow enables seamless switching between multiple devices (Bluetooth or 2.4GHz).

  • DPI/CPI: 4/5 - Adjustable up to 4000 DPI for precise cursor control.

  • Polling Rate: 4/5 - 1000Hz for lag-free responsiveness.

  • Battery Life: 4/5 - Up to 4 months on a single charge.

  • Price: 4/5 - Moderate, typically around $90.

2. Evoluent VerticalMouse 4:

  • Comfort & Ergonomics: 5/5 - Patented design maintains neutral hand posture, multiple sizes and left-handed option available.

  • Functionality: 3/5 - 6 programmable buttons, standard scroll wheel.

  • Connectivity: 2/5 - Wired USB only, reliable but limits freedom of movement.

  • DPI/CPI: 3/5 - Adjustable up to 2000 DPI, sufficient for most tasks.

  • Polling Rate: 3/5 - 1000Hz for smooth tracking.

  • Battery Life: N/A - Wired mouse.

  • Price: 3/5 - Affordable, typically around $80.

3. Logitech Lift:

  • Comfort & Ergonomics: 4/5 - Relaxed 50° angle, lightweight design for smaller hands.

  • Functionality: 3/5 - 4 programmable buttons, quiet click buttons.

  • Connectivity: 3/5 - Bluetooth or 2.4GHz dongle, versatile connection options.

  • DPI/CPI: 4/5 - Adjustable up to 4000 DPI for accurate cursor movement.

  • Polling Rate: 3/5 - 1000Hz for responsive tracking.

  • Battery Life: 3/5 - Up to 2 months on a single charge.

  • Price: 3/5 - Affordable, typically around $70.

4. Evoluent Vertical C:

  • Comfort & Ergonomics: 4/5 - Compact design for smaller hands, comfortable vertical grip.

  • Functionality: 3/5 - 3 programmable buttons, basic scroll wheel.

  • Connectivity: 2/5 - Wired USB only, restricts movement around your workspace.

  • DPI/CPI: 3/5 - Adjustable up to 1600 DPI, adequate for everyday use.

  • Polling Rate: 3/5 - 500Hz for decent responsiveness.

  • Battery Life: N/A - Wired mouse.

  • Price: 2/5 - Budget-friendly, typically around $50.

Anker AK-UBA
Anker AK-UBA

5. Anker AK-UBA:

  • Comfort & Ergonomics: 3/5 - Affordable vertical design, less sculpted grip.

  • Functionality: 3/5 - 5 programmable buttons, standard scroll wheel.

  • Connectivity: 2/5 - Wired USB only, limits mobility.

  • DPI/CPI: 3/5 - Adjustable up to 1600 DPI, suitable for basic tasks.

  • Polling Rate: 2/5 - 125Hz, may experience slight cursor lag.

  • Battery Life: N/A - Wired mouse.

  • Price: 5/5 - Most affordable option, typically around $30.
